Analysis
The most recent figure for prim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in Curacao is 872.7 BoP, current US$ per person, measured in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 18.8% on the previous year and down 17.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, primary income payments (bop, current us$), per capita in Curacao peaked at 1,075 BoP, current US$ per person in 2022 and was at its lowest, 700.73 BoP, current US$ per person, in 2020.
Curacao ranks 77th of 200 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 13 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Primary income payments Balance of Payments Statistics Yearbook and data files, International Monetary Fund (IMF)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
